Brief summary

Modern Rose, floribunda "Grafin Elke zu Rantzau", Germany, introduced by Kordes Rosen in 2019, Usually is pink, ivory in color, high-center (point) bloom shape, blooms 9 cm in size, has 1-3 buds per stem, repeat rebloom, has rich fragrance, the bush shape can be bushy, 80 cm in height, 50 cm in width, suitable for USDA zone 6 from -23°C and above, moderate resistance to rain, strong resistance to black spot, strong resistance to mildew.

More information

Flowers 9 cm in diameter, double, creamy with a pale pink blush, borne in small inflorescences. The fragrance is strong, with fruit, myrrh, and spice notes, reaching peak intensity in the morning, at noon, and in the evening. Blooming repeats throughout the season. The foliage is highly resistant to black spot and resistant to powdery mildew. The bush is upright and dense; grown as a bush it reaches up to 80 cm in height and up to 50 cm in width, and grown as a standard the height depends on the grafting point.
